Shopify and Digital Commerce Technologies
Shopify Inc. (TSX:SHOP) operates a commerce platform used by merchants across multiple regions. The company provides tools for online storefronts, payment processing, inventory management, marketing activities, and customer engagement.

Constellation Software and Enterprise Solutions
Constellation Software Inc. (TSX:CSU) focuses on acquiring, managing, and developing software businesses that serve specialized industries and niche markets. Operations span numerous vertical market software segments across multiple countries.
The company's portfolio structure includes software providers serving sectors such as healthcare, public administration, transportation, education, manufacturing, utilities, and financial services. CGI and Information Technology Services
CGI Inc. (TSX:GIB.A) provides consulting, systems integration, managed services, and information technology outsourcing solutions. Operations extend across North America, Europe, and additional international markets.

Broader Canadian AI-Related Names
Several additional Canadian companies are often mentioned in discussions involving AI-related themes. Celestica Inc. (TSX:CLS) participates in electronics manufacturing and supply-chain solutions, while Kinaxis Inc. (TSX:KXS) develops supply-chain management software. Docebo Inc. (TSX:DCBO) operates in the learning management software segment.
